Output 56d9df75e03cfcf11fe2e6db5aee74ef0751ab30f06a180ee194d6c028086c46:8

value
22912408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b35af50d62267a9854f88422da7f9a969745b6c OP_EQUAL
address
MSRdiTaAWXWU6itbKJWBYa9ng3zg4o8U6d
transaction
56d9df75e03cfcf11fe2e6db5aee74ef0751ab30f06a180ee194d6c028086c46
spent
false